Which volcanoes have a clearly layered structure? Select all that apply.A.cinder coneB.stratovolcanoC.shield volcano

Answer: B. Stratovolcano

Step-by-step explanation:

A volcano is a hazardous event which is associated with emergence of hot lava below the surface of earth crust. This is caused by the development of heat and pressure below the surface of earth crust. The hot lava emerge out with a explosion.

A stratovolcano is also called as the composite volcano. It appears in the form of cone. It is associated with many layers or strata of hardened lava, ash, pumice and tephra. The lava flowing from the stratovolcanoes typically cools and hardens before it spreads too far from it's site of origin, because of high viscosity.
